As summer season methods, equine entrepreneurs experience different challenges in retaining the wellbeing and comfort in their horses. 1 major issue for the duration of this time is equine summer sores, that may result in sizeable pain and difficulties if not tackled instantly.

Equine summer sores are due to a type of parasitic infection connected to the Habronema larvae. These sores ordinarily seem as agonizing, ulcerative lesions on the skin, generally around the legs, belly, and confront. The larvae are deposited by flies, building efficient fly Handle important in preventing these sores.

Scratches, also known as pastern dermatitis or scratches in horses, are A different skin situation that may be aggravated by damp circumstances. This affliction results in crusty, inflamed pores and skin, often necessitating a mix of cleaning, drying, and topical therapies to manage efficiently.

Summer months sores in horses, specially These a result of Habronema larvae, require distinct habronema summer months sores equines therapy. This commonly involves the use of anti-parasitic prescription drugs and topical treatments prescribed by a veterinarian to very clear the an infection and endorse healing.
